F14 GTA is a 1988 Renault Gta in Silver with a 2,458c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 1988 Renault Gta models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.8% with a typical mileage of 90,754 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Gta f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 318 recorded failures. If you're considering buying F14 GTA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Gta typically stays on UK roads for around 40 years. At 38 years old, this Renault Gta is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
